Publisher's Synopsis
The Code Destroys
Book 3 in the Hidden in the Code series
by A.J. Stephens
When a dismantled AI begins echoing across the globe, elite hacker Amy Hubbard and former operative Sean Butler are pulled into a deadly race to extinguish a system that was never supposed to survive.
But Dominion didn't just live, it evolved. From Berlin to Cairo, Tokyo to D.C., they chase ghost signals buried in everyday tech, uncovering mimic protocols built from Amy's own past.
Every node they destroy reveals another layer of deception. Every city hides a system watching, predicting, replicating.
And behind it all, the Big Man is orchestrating a new world order powered by behavior, not bullets.
Amy's identity becomes the battlefield. The code was designed to learn all her traits. Now it wants to replace her.
This time, exposure isn't enough.
To destroy the system, they'll have to erase the future it's already written.
